Abstract (en)

[origin: EP3986055A1] A communication method and apparatus are provided. The method includes: A terminal device determines a first transmission time period and a second transmission time period, where the first transmission time period includes X1 time units, the second transmission time period includes X2 time units, and the first transmission time period does not overlap the second transmission time period. The terminal device sends a first reference signal in the first transmission time period and a first uplink signal in the second transmission time period, where the first uplink signal includes at least one of a PUSCH, a PUCCH, or a DMRS. Therefore, the terminal device may additionally send the first reference signal, to improve uplink channel estimation performance of a network device. This improves coverage performance of a communication system.
